Replace Treo 755p's Battery Without Replacing Back Cover

Seidio is now offering a new extended lithium ion battery for the Treo 755p that doesn't require you to replace that smartphone's battery door. This 2200mAh battery, which replaces the standard 1600mAh type bundled with the Treo, promises to deliver 37 percent more power for $59.95.

Although it does this without requiring the user to replace the back cover of their smartphone, Seidio does include a free replacement door with the battery, however. The company says this is because of small variations in individual devices that may introduce fitting issues.

If you don't mind replacing your smartphone's door and introducing a large (unsightly) hump on the back of your device, there's an even more powerful 3200mAh battery available from Seido.

It doubles the amount of power delivered by the standard 1600mAH battery for $10 more than Seido's 2200mAh battery.
